Ubuntu github 加速的最佳实践是什么?

什么是Ubuntu GitHub加速?

Ubuntu GitHub加速是提升下载速度的有效方法。在使用GitHub进行开发时,尤其是当你在中国大陆地区,可能会遇到访问速度慢的问题。这主要是由于网络限制和跨境数据传输造成的。为了提高代码库的下载效率,很多用户开始寻求加速解决方案。

GitHub加速的基本原理是通过使用代理服务器或镜像站点来优化数据传输。通过这些加速器,用户可以绕过网络限制,从而提高访问速度。常见的加速器包括国内的一些镜像服务,它们能够更快地响应请求,减少延迟。

在选择合适的GitHub加速器时,你需要考虑几个因素。首先是服务的稳定性,确保加速器能够长期有效地提供服务。其次是访问速度,理想的加速器能够在不同的时间段保持较快的下载速度。此外,安全性也是一个重要考虑因素,确保你的数据不会在传输过程中被泄露。

为了帮助你更好地理解,以下是一些常见的GitHub加速器及其特点:

  • FastGit:提供快速的GitHub访问,用户反馈良好。
  • GitClone:支持多种GitHub项目的加速,适合大多数开发者。
  • Gitee:国内知名的代码托管平台,提供GitHub项目的镜像服务。

使用这些加速器时,你通常需要在Git配置中进行一些设置。例如,可以通过修改.gitconfig文件来指定使用的加速器地址。这样,当你执行git clone命令时,系统会自动使用加速器进行操作,从而提高速度。

总之,Ubuntu GitHub加速是改善开发体验的重要手段。通过合理选择和设置加速器,你可以大幅提升代码下载的效率,节省时间,专注于开发工作。更多关于加速器的具体使用方法,可以参考一些开发者社区的讨论和教程,例如简书上的相关内容。

为什么需要加速Ubuntu GitHub?

加速Ubuntu GitHub可以显著提升开发效率。在使用Ubuntu系统进行开发时,GitHub是一个不可或缺的工具,然而,由于网络环境的限制,访问GitHub的速度常常受到影响,这不仅浪费了时间,还可能影响开发进度。

首先,GitHub作为全球最大的代码托管平台,拥有海量的开源项目和代码库。无论是下载依赖包还是获取最新的项目更新,速度的快慢直接关系到开发周期的长短。尤其是在进行团队协作时,任何延迟都可能导致项目进度的推迟。

其次,许多开发者在Ubuntu上使用Git进行版本控制,频繁的提交和拉取操作需要快速的网络连接。如果你的网络速度较慢,可能会影响到代码的同步和更新,进而导致团队成员之间的信息不对称。

此外,GitHub上的许多大型项目,尤其是那些包含大量文件和历史记录的项目,下载和更新时需要消耗大量的带宽和时间。这就要求开发者采用一些加速手段,以提高这些操作的效率。

最后,使用GitHub加速器不仅可以提升访问速度,还能优化网络资源的使用。通过缓存机制,GitHub加速器能够减少重复数据的传输,从而节省带宽,提高整体工作效率。这对于需要频繁访问GitHub的开发者来说,尤其重要。

综上所述,了解并应用GitHub加速器的最佳实践,将帮助你在Ubuntu的开发工作中获得显著的效率提升。通过合理配置和使用加速工具,能够有效地克服网络带来的制约,确保项目的顺利进行。

如何配置Ubuntu以实现GitHub加速?

配置Ubuntu以实现GitHub加速的关键步骤。

在现代软件开发中,使用GitHub是不可或缺的。然而,由于网络速度的限制,许多用户在使用GitHub时可能会遇到速度缓慢的问题。为了提升使用体验,配置Ubuntu以实现GitHub加速尤为重要。在本文中,你将学习如何通过简单的步骤来优化你的Ubuntu系统,以便更快地访问GitHub。

首先,安装必要的工具是加速的第一步。你可以使用以下命令来安装Git和Curl,这些工具在获取代码时非常有用:

  • 打开终端,输入:sudo apt update
  • 接着,安装Git:sudo apt install git
  • 最后,安装Curl:sudo apt install curl

完成这些步骤后,你将能够在终端中使用Git和Curl命令,这为后续的加速配置打下了基础。

接下来,配置GitHub的加速器是提升速度的关键。你可以选择使用一些公共的GitHub加速器,如FastGit或GitClone。以FastGit为例,你可以按照以下步骤进行配置:

  • 在终端中输入:git config --global url."https://fastgit.org/".insteadOf "https://github.com/"
  • 这条命令会将所有对GitHub的请求自动重定向到FastGit,加速访问速度。

此外,确保你的网络环境是稳定的。使用VPN或代理服务器可以进一步提升访问速度。选择一个高质量的VPN服务,连接后再进行GitHub操作,通常会显著改善速度。

最后,定期更新你的Ubuntu系统也是保证性能的关键。你可以通过以下命令来保持系统最新:

  • 输入:sudo apt update && sudo apt upgrade
  • 这条命令将确保所有软件包都更新到最新版本,从而提高安全性和性能。

通过以上步骤,你将能够有效地配置Ubuntu系统,实现GitHub的加速访问。这样不仅能节省时间,还能提高开发效率。对于开发者而言,快速、流畅的操作体验无疑是提升工作效率的重要因素。

有哪些常用的GitHub加速工具和资源?

选择合适的GitHub加速工具可以显著提升效率。

在使用GitHub时,由于网络环境的不同,访问速度可能会受到影响。幸运的是,有许多工具和资源可以帮助您加速GitHub的访问。了解这些工具的使用方法,可以让您在项目开发中事半功倍。

首先,GitHub加速器是一个常用的解决方案。这类加速器通过优化网络连接,提供更快速的访问体验。您可以使用一些知名的GitHub加速器,如FastGitGitClone。这些工具不仅能加速克隆速度,还能提升下载和上传的效率。

其次,使用镜像站点也是一种有效的方式。某些公司和组织提供GitHub的镜像服务,例如gitee.com。通过这些镜像站点,您可以直接从国内服务器获取资源,从而减少延迟和提高下载速度。

除了加速器和镜像,代理工具也可以帮助您更顺畅地访问GitHub。使用VPN或HTTP代理,您可以绕过网络限制,享受更稳定的连接。推荐使用一些知名的VPN服务,如ExpressVPNNordVPN,这些服务提供高效的加速体验。

此外,GitHub CLI(命令行界面)也是一个值得考虑的工具。它允许您通过命令行与GitHub进行交互,减少了网页加载时间。使用CLI时,您可以直接在终端中执行各种操作,提升工作效率。

最后,您还可以关注一些社区和论坛,获取最新的加速工具和技巧。网站如SegmentFaultCSDN上经常会有用户分享他们的经验和推荐的工具。通过这些资源,您可以不断优化自己的GitHub使用体验。

综上所述,选择合适的GitHub加速工具和资源,不仅能提高访问速度,还能提升您的开发效率。希望您能根据自己的需求,选择最适合的解决方案。

如何测试和验证GitHub加速效果?

测试GitHub加速效果是优化的关键步骤。通过准确的验证,你能够确保加速器的有效性,从而提高工作效率。

首先,你需要选择一个合适的测试工具。比如,使用命令行中的`ping`命令,可以快速检查与GitHub服务器的延迟。这种方法简单易行,可以作为初步评估的手段。通过执行以下命令,你可以获取到响应时间:

  1. 打开终端。
  2. 输入命令:ping github.com
  3. 查看返回的平均延迟时间。

其次,使用`traceroute`命令可以帮助你识别数据包从本地到GitHub的路径及每一跳的延迟情况。这对分析网络瓶颈非常有效。在终端中输入以下命令:

  1. 打开终端。
  2. 输入命令:traceroute github.com
  3. 观察每个节点的响应时间。

除了命令行工具外,使用在线服务也是一种有效的方法。例如,网站如 WebPageTest 可以提供详细的加载时间和性能分析。通过这些工具,你可以对比加速器启用前后的性能差异。

在进行测试时,建议多次运行测试,以获得更准确的平均值。比如,你可以在不同时间段进行测试,观察网络流量的变化对加速效果的影响。记录下每次测试的结果,便于后续分析。

最后,结合结果进行分析。确保将测试结果与未使用加速器时的数据进行对比。通过对比,你可以清晰地看到加速器带来的性能提升,进一步优化你的使用策略。

常见问题

什么是Ubuntu GitHub加速?

Ubuntu GitHub加速是通过使用代理服务器或镜像站点来提升GitHub下载速度的有效方法。

为什么需要加速Ubuntu GitHub?

加速Ubuntu GitHub可以显著提升开发效率,尤其是在网络环境受限时。

如何配置Ubuntu以实现GitHub加速?

配置Ubuntu以实现GitHub加速的关键步骤包括安装加速器并在.gitconfig文件中进行设置。

参考文献

GitHub官方网站

Ubuntu官方网站

简书开发者社区

最新博客

什么是Ubuntu GitHub加速?

Ubuntu G

什么是Github加速器?

Github加速器是提高访问

使用Github加速器是什么?

Github加速器是提升

什么是Github加速访问?

Github加速访问是提升

什么是GitHub加速器?

GitHub加速器是提升访问

热门话题

什么是Github代理?

Github代理是提高访问速度

使用GitHub加速镜像有什么好处?

使用GitHub加

什么是GitHub加速器?

在当今软件开发的世界中,GitHub已经成为

什么是GitHub加速器?

GitHub加速器是一种专门为用户提供的工具

引言:为什么选择Github来加速网站

在当今数字化时代,网站的加载速度